Changeset 1954 for GTP/trunk/Lib


Ignore:
Timestamp:
01/08/07 02:23:18 (18 years ago)
Author:
mattausch
Message:
 
Location:
GTP/trunk/Lib/Vis/Preprocessing/src
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• GTP/trunk/Lib/Vis/Preprocessing/src/GlobalLinesRenderer.cpp

    r1953 r1954  
    241241        glLoadIdentity(); 
    242242 
     243        // init the receiving buffers 
     244        mNewDepthBuffer = new float[texWidth * texHeight]; 
     245        mOldDepthBuffer = new float[texWidth * texHeight]; 
     246         
     247        mNewItemBuffer = new int[texWidth * texHeight *4]; 
     248        mOldItemBuffer = new int[texWidth * texHeight *4]; 
     249         
    243250        AxisAlignedBox3 bbox = globalLinesRenderer->mPreprocessor->mKdTree->GetBox(); 
    244251         
     
    437444 
    438445 
    439 void GlobalLinesRenderer::GrabItemBuffer(float *data, RenderTexture *rt) 
     446void GlobalLinesRenderer::GrabItemBuffer(int *data, RenderTexture *rt) 
    440447{ 
    441448        rt->BindDepth(); 
  • GTP/trunk/Lib/Vis/Preprocessing/src/GlobalLinesRenderer.h

    r1953 r1954  
    5050void Run(); 
    5151void GrabDepthBuffer(float *data, RenderTexture *rt); 
    52 void GrabItemBuffer(float *data, RenderTexture *rt); 
     52void GrabItemBuffer(int *data, RenderTexture *rt); 
    5353void ApplyDepthPeeling(Beam &beam, const int samples); 
    5454void ExportDepthBuffer(); 
     
    6464        float *mNewDepthBuffer; 
    6565        float *mOldDepthBuffer; 
    66         float *mNewItemBuffer; 
    67         float *mOldItemBuffer; 
     66        int *mNewItemBuffer; 
     67        int *mOldItemBuffer; 
    6868RenderTexture *mNewTexture; 
    6969        RenderTexture *mOldTexture; 
Note: See TracChangeset for help on using the changeset viewer.